Flow Characteristics of the Ballistic Research Laboratories' Supersonic Wind Tunnel
Author: Clarence C. Bush
Publisher:
ISBN:
Category :
Languages : en
Pages : 52
Book Description
The Ballistic Research Laboratories' Supersonic Wind Tunnel No. 1 flow characteristics are presented in detail to assist those who may wish to make use of the facility. Techniques and instrumentation used i calibrating supersonic nozzles for Mach number and flow direction distributions are discussed, as well as nozzle adjustment procedures used to improve the flow in the tsting region for nozzles with flexible walls. (Author).

Wind Tunnel Supply Headers
Author: Anders S. Platou
Publisher:
ISBN:
Category : Wind tunnels
Languages : en
Pages : 54
Book Description
It has been found that good quality, low turbulence flow in a wind tunnel test section is dependent on the flow and turbulence conditions in the supply header. This report indicates how good quality, low turbulence flow can be obtained in a supply header and presents flow surveys taken in a supply header before and after modification. (Author).

Vapor Screen Technique Development at the Ballistic Research Laboratories
Author: Charles J. Nietubicz
Publisher:
ISBN:
Category :
Languages : en
Pages : 32
Book Description
Results of the vapor screen technique development in the Ballistic Research Laboratories Supersonic Wind Tunnel No. 1 are presented. A standard light source in conjunction with a schlieren mirror system are compared photographically with the results of using a laser light source. The amount of condensation required, photographic equipment and testing procedure are presented. Vapor screen pictures of main body vortices, photographed through a downstream prism as well as through the tunnel access window are shown. A unique photograph showing a set of vortices being generated prior to separation is presented. The wind tunnel tests were conducted at Mach number 2.25. (Author).
